Subject: Handover — Vaultspin rotation utility

Taking over Vaultspin releases from me as of Friday. Support should know: rotations run nightly; failures page the platform channel, not support. If a rotation stalls, rerun with `--resume`, never `--force`. Release bundles must be signed before upload or agents reject them. Current signing key for the release pipeline is below.

deploy key for kajof-fajop: bky6_gDHw9Q

## Migration Guide — Step 4: Switch producers to Relayline

At this point the homegrown queue (internally called Bucketbrigade) should be in drain-only mode. All new work must be enqueued through Relayline instead. Update each producer service to point at the Relayline broker and remove the Bucketbrigade client library from its dependencies. Run the smoke suite before promoting; a producer that still writes to Bucketbrigade will silently lose jobs once the drain completes next week. Configure each producer with the following values.

deployment values, tafog-kagap:
wenath:
  pin: 4244
  metrics_host: metrics.wenath.lumicsys.internal
  tenant: istix
  seal: seal_10585894

## 2.9.0 — Setting renamed for broker upgrade

BROKER_URL is now MSGBUS_ENDPOINT as part of the Copperline broker upgrade to v5. Old name removed, no fallback. Consumers must redeploy before Thursday's cutover. The v5 broker drops plaintext auth; connections now require the rotated access token. Migration steps: update the endpoint name in .env, bump the client library to 5.x, restart workers in the hollow-creek cluster, and verify lag dashboards. After the endpoint line, add the broker token on the following line in .env.

sealed setting: LEDGER_TOKEN13=5d842615a26d7

// Config hot-reloading for the Brindlemere client.
// The watcher polls /etc/brindlemere/client.toml every 15s and applies
// changes without a restart. Connection pool size, retry budgets, and
// timeout values are all reloadable; endpoint URLs are not, by design,
// since swapping hosts mid-flight corrupted the session cache in the
// 3.2 release. Reload events are logged at INFO so the release manager
// can confirm rollout without shelling in. The client authenticates to
// the internal Fennic registry with the key that follows.

app token of tageg-kadug = vxb2-26